For the Petitioner/s : Mr. Rajesh Kumar, Advocate For the Opposite Party/s : Mr. Sri Awadhesh Kumar Singh, APP ====================================================== CORAM: HONOURABLE MR. JUSTICE DINESH KUMAR SINGH ORAL ORDER 25-10-2016 Heard learned counsels for the petitioner and the State.
The petitioner being the daughter of the informant is languishing in custody since 24.06.2016 in a case registered for the offences punishable under sections 498A, 341, 307, 494, 347, 323 of the Indian Penal Code and 3/4 of the Dowry Prohibition Act.
Basic accusation is of torture for non-fulfillment of dowry demand, assault and performing second marriage. Learned counsel for the petitioner submits that the petitioner admits his marriage with the informant and he is ready to keep her as wife with full dignity and honour. A statement to that effect has been made in para 11 of the petition which reads as follows:-
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.45216 of 2016 (2) dt.25-10-2016 2/2 "That the petitioner is ready to keep the informant's daughter with full honour and dignity as his wife." It is further submitted that the investigation has already concluded.
Considering the nature of accusation and the investigation being concluded, let the above named petitioner be released on bail, on furnishing bail bond of Rs.10,000/- (ten thousand) with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of learned CJM, Khagaria, in connection with Maheshkhunt P.S. Case No.53/2016.
